ServiceNow Names Saif Mashat as Area Vice President for MEA

ServiceNow

ServiceNow has announced the appointment of Saif Mashat as Area Vice President for the Middle East and Africa (MEA), effective April 1, 2025. In his new role, Mashat will oversee the company’s operations and strategy across the region while continuing to lead ServiceNow’s business in Saudi Arabia.

Mashat brings extensive experience from leading global technology firms, including VMware, IBM, SAP, Oracle, and Microsoft. He has a strong track record of scaling technology businesses and product lines to market-leading positions. His leadership is expected to strengthen ServiceNow’s presence in the MEA region and drive digital transformation for customers.

The appointment reflects ServiceNow’s ongoing commitment to expanding its footprint in MEA, strengthening regional partnerships, and supporting enterprises in their digital transformation journeys.
